The first converts to Islam at the time of Muhammad were Khadija bint Khuwaylid, Ali ibn Abi Talib, and Zayd ibn Harithah. Khadija was the first person to convert, and the first free female convert. Ali was the first free male child in Muhammad’s family to convert. Zayd was the first freed slave male convert.

The Five Pillars of Islam are the core beliefs and practices of the Islamic faith. The Profession of Faith, or shahada, is the central tenet of Islam, and states that “There is no god but God, and Muhammad is the Messenger of God.” Prayer, or salat, is an important practice in Islam, as is giving alms, or zakat. Fasting, or sawm, is another key pillar of Islam, and is often observed during the month of Ramadan. Finally, the pilgrimage to Mecca, or hajj, is a key practice for Muslims.

According to Muslim tradition, it was Muhammad’s wife Khadija who first believed he was a prophet. She was followed by his ten-year-old cousin Ali ibn Abi Talib, close friend Abu Bakr, and adopted son Zaid. Around 613, Muhammad began to preach to the public.
